Drug Rehab in New Providence

Struggling with any type of drug addiction is a serious burden to carry, and one which comes with numerous consequences if left unresolved. People with the greatest of intentions who want to stop usually try and do so numerous times over with no success, and wind up just falling deeper into a life of addiction. There are reasons why individuals cannot quit on their own, and these motives are what make drug rehabilitation in New Providence a more effective and verified method of handling drug addiction.

The added benefits of a drug rehab in New Providence consist of having the support and tools at hand to fix any complications and challenges that may come up through detox and withdrawal, as well as the opportunity to address the real problems that triggered drug addiction which are normally not physical ones at all. For example, many individuals become involved in substance abuse to mask and keep away from significant problems in their lives. If one only attempts to overcome the physical cravings and such on one's own, they really aren't making any headway at really resolving the mental and emotional problems, that once resolved, will ensure long-term sobriety.

Once a person comes to terms with the reality that they need assistance to resolve drug addiction, the next step is deciding on the appropriate drug rehab for them. Some drug treatment programs don't require any type of inpatient stay and supply services on an outpatient basis for example. At this type of drug rehab the person receives treatment through the day and returns home in the evening. While this type of drug rehab may seem convenient, it will not provide the proper treatment environment for someone who needs to step away from drug influences and other conditions which could compromise one's sobriety. The most confirmed and effective treatment settings are those which call for an inpatient or residential stay, so that the person can concentrate entirely on bettering themselves and healing from addiction, not on every day interruptions and drug addiction triggers.

For instance, someone or some circumstance in one's environment could be the actual cause of one's drug use. If the individual returns to this each day while in drug rehab, all gains will be lost and most will typically relapse. There are also various lengths of stay even in inpatient and residential drug treatment programs, with treatment curriculums varying from 30 days to up to a year for some. As a rule of thumb, a person who is intent on resolving addiction issues once and for all should remain in drug rehab as long as it requires. A month in treatment is hardly enough time to even recover physically from chronic substance abuse. A substantial amount of time is needed, even months in some instances, to benefit from intensive therapy and other treatment tools to heal psychologically and emotionally so that one can genuinely make a fresh start once treatment is finished.

The price of drug rehab can fluctuate substantially of course, depending on the facilities offered, length of stay, etc. While expense should never be an impediment to getting life-saving treatment in drug rehab, it is a logistic that some may have concern over. After all, addiction is inclined to exhaust all assets and it can be difficult to pay for drug rehab when the time comes. Fortunately, most private drug treatment programs accept many forms of private health insurance as well as Medicare and Medicaid. Some drug treatment programs will even work with individuals to either supply payment assistance or supply a sliding fee scale based mostly off of one's earnings and individual circumstances. Addicted persons and their family members will find that treatment counselors are more than willing to help offer solutions and support to get the logistical and monetary concerns resolved so that these are not a barrier to getting the individuals started in drug rehab.
